This chemical composition of wine graphic doesn’t represent every wine, but was put together as a baseline of what’s in wine. Red wines vary in alcohol content from 11% – 15% generally, which would change the above model.
Also if you read The Healthiest Wines article, you’ll see that the resveratrol content can vary depending on the growing conditions as well.

Vitamin Content of Wine
- thiamin
- riboflavin
- niacin
- Vitamins A, B, K & G
- folate
- choline
- betaine
- lutein
- zeakanthin
Mineral Content of Wine
- Sodium
- Calcium
- Iron
- Magnesium
- Phosphorus
- Potassium
- Zinc
- Copper
- Manganese
- Fluoride
- Selenium
Heart Healthy Nutrient Content of Wine
- OPC’s
- Resveratrol
- Flavonoids (Catechins, Quercetin, Anthocyanins)
- Bioflavonoids
- Phenolic Compounds
- Tannins
Other Chemical Compounds in Wine
- Sugar
- Sulfites
- Grape Thumatin-like proteins
- Amino Acids
- Citric Acid
- Gallic Acid
- Tartic Acid
- Mallic Acid
- Succinic Acid
- Acetic Acid
- Lactic Acid
